Prince Edward Island’s latest PNP draw invited 188 candidates



The immigration draw for Prince Edward Island was held on November 18.

188 immigration hopefuls applied for a provincial nomination under the Prince Edward Island Provincial Nominee Program (PEI PNP).

Express Entry and Labour Impact applicants received the majority of the invites (172). Business Impact candidates with at least 67 points in the province’s immigration system received the remaining 16 invites.

The Express Entry Category of the PEI PNP is an improved PNP, meaning it is linked to the federal government’s Express Entry system. Candidates must have a profile in the system to be considered for this stream.

Express Entry is a service that manages immigration applications. It processes applications for the Federal Skilled Worker Program, Federal Skilled Trades Program, and Canadian Experience Class, which are all economic-class immigration programs.

Eligible candidates are given a CRS score based on their age, work experience, education, and English or French language competency.

PEI sponsors a Provincial Nominee Program (PNP) invitation round once a month. The total number of invitations issued this year is currently 1,729.

PNPs allow Canadian provinces and territories to select immigrants who meet their labor market needs. This is true in Prince Edward Island, which administers the Prince Edward Island Provincial Nominee Program in accordance with nationally approved rules (PEI PNP).

The next Prince Edward Island PNP draw will be held on December 16, 2021.

Express Entry candidates who are nominated by a province gain an extra 600 points on their CRS score and are practically guaranteed an Invitation to Apply (ITA) for permanent residence in the next Express Entry draw.

Express Entry candidates must develop an Expression of Interest (EOI) profile with the PEI PNP in order to be eligible for a provincial nomination.

The province’s unique points grid is used to assign points to EOI profiles. The candidates with the highest scores are then asked to apply in monthly lotteries.

Impact on the Workforce

Foreign nationals who have a valid work offer in PEI and are supported by their company are eligible for the Labour Impact Category. Skilled Worker, Critical Worker, and International Graduate are the three streams.

In order to be considered for a provincial nomination under the Labour Impact Category, candidates in this category must also submit an Expression of Interest.

Category for Business Impact

Candidates in the Business Impact Category must meet the provincial minimum score criterion in order to continue with their applications. Every draw has a different score. PEI issued invitations under the Work Permit Stream, which is for international entrepreneurs who desire to establish and operate a business on the island.
